javascript - jQuery CDN 缓存统计

标签 javascript jquery performance caching

我正在考虑放弃 jQuery 并将其替换为主要用于移动浏览器的 vanilla js 代码。

不过,我还了解到大多数用户的浏览器中已经缓存了 jQuery CDN 版本,因此他们实际上不需要下载它。如果移动浏览器确实也是这种情况,它可以为我节省大量代码重写时间。

由于我的网站尚未上线,我自己无法获得指示,因此我正在寻找一般统计数据,以了解浏览器中缓存了 jQuery 库的用户与未缓存的用户的估计百分比。 任何帮助将不胜感激。

最佳答案

好吧,首先,如果用户一直在访问使用 jQuery CDN 的网站,他的浏览器将已经拥有该库。

this statistics .这意味着前 100 万个网站中有 30,000 个正在使用 jQuery CDN。

因此用户很有可能已经访问过其中一个网站。

另一个问题是为什么你需要为移动重写这个? jQuery 文件大小为 84KB。它被下载并缓存一次。您的 HTML 可能花费更多,但每次都会被下载。不要无中生有地制造问题,继续使用 jQuery 并花更多时间改进真正重要的事情。

关于javascript - jQuery CDN 缓存统计,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31669460/

相关文章:

javascript - 未捕获 没有定义元素?

jQuery SlideDown 回调(如果完成或失败).. 'always' 选项

android - 改进 Windows 7 x64 上的 Android 模拟器性能

java - 为什么亚马逊 ec2 的性能会下降很多?

javascript - 如何在网页上复制文本内容30秒后显示DIV?

javascript - 如何匹配某物。 "preceeded/followed by"有正则表达式的东西吗?

php - Jquery Ajax 返回数组 - 如何在 Javascript 中处理

javascript - 如何在表中搜索两个年龄之间

javascript - 如何使 EXPECT 条件等待 promise 得到解决(代码包装在方法中)?

python - 如何在 Python 中创建具有相应索引条件的 bool 矩阵?